What is a Cold Wallet?

A cold wallet refers to a type of cryptocurrency wallet that is not connected to the internet. This offline storage method significantly reduces the risk of hacking and unauthorized access. Unlike hot wallets, which are online and more convenient for frequent transactions, cold wallets prioritize security over accessibility. They are ideal for long-term storage of cryptocurrencies.

Types of Cold Wallets

There are several types of cold wallets available, each with its unique features:

  • Hardware Wallets: These are physical devices designed specifically for storing cryptocurrencies. They offer robust security features and are user-friendly.
  • Paper Wallets: A paper wallet involves printing your private keys and public addresses on paper. While this method is highly secure, it requires careful handling to avoid damage or loss.
  • Metal Wallets: Similar to paper wallets, metal wallets involve engraving your keys onto metal plates. This method provides durability against fire and water damage.

Why Use a Cold Wallet?

Investors often wonder, "Why should I use a cold wallet?" The answer lies in the enhanced security it offers. Here are some compelling reasons:

  1. Protection Against Hacks: Since cold wallets are offline, they are immune to online attacks.
  2. Long-term Storage: Cold wallets are perfect for investors looking to hold their assets for an extended period.
  3. Control Over Private Keys: With a cold wallet, you have complete control over your private keys, reducing reliance on third-party services.
